Determination of 25 Imidazole Veterinary Drugs and Their Metabolites in Eggs by High Performance Liquid Chromatography
The method for the determination of 25 imidazole veterinary drugs and their metabolites in eggs was established by high performance liquid chromatography(HPLC). The egg solution was extracted and concentrated by acetonitrile,purified by Oasis PRIME HLB solid phase extraction column. The samples were eluted by gradient with methanol and water as mobile phases,separated by ZORBAX SB-Aq(250 mm×4.6 mm,5 μm) column,detected by diode array detector(DAD),and quantified by external standard method. The results demonstrated that the 25 compounds showed good linear relationships in their linear ranges with the correlation coefficients(
r
2
) greater than 0.999. And the limits of detection(LODs) and quantification(LOQs) were 0.8-5.0 μg/kg and 2.5-12.5 μg/kg,respectively. The average recoveries ranged from 78.5% to 103% and the relative standard deviations(RSDs) ranged from 1.1% to 6.5% at three concentration levels.
